Russian around
THE IRISH ORGANISERS of the Russian Orphans Holiday Project are looking for artists of all musical persuasions who’d like to take part in an upcoming fundraising gig.
"We’ve a couple of good acts who’ve agreed to play for us, but need more," says Dermot Brannick who’s just back from a four month stint in Siberia. "We need to raise £21,000 to cover the Holiday Project by Christmas."
